Question:

What is the maximum temperature rating for a solar controller?

Answer:

The specific model and manufacturer are factors that can cause the maximum temperature rating for a solar controller to differ. Nevertheless, a majority of well-made solar controllers are engineered to function effectively within a broad spectrum of temperatures, typically spanning from -40°C to 85°C (-40°F to 185°F). This wide temperature range guarantees that the controller remains resilient and durable, even in the face of harsh weather conditions like scorching summers or freezing winters. To ascertain the maximum temperature rating for a particular solar controller model, it is imperative to refer to the manufacturer's specifications or user manual.
